The full lists were available to download on their website. All you missed out on in total were the Magic Items, the Dwarf vs Chaos Dwarf campaign (not sure how much content there was there) and alternate "ZZap!" rules from the Basilean book.

Could Mantic be more clear on the download page that these free rules are not the full rules and that the army lists have more units that will be published in the full version of the rulebook?

Apologies on facebook for having been unclear in communication is all well and good. Not everyone sees those posts however (not everyone has facebook, much less check it regularly or are 'friends' with Mantic there).

There are lots of folks being confused at the moment, thinking units have been removes etc., and it would be very easily avoided of Mantic just updated the text on their homepage to be more clear. They have had two days now since the release of the free rules.

Also, please add some kind of version number on the PDF's for clarity.
